Indoor Rally Cardiff
The Welsh rally broke new records today by staging the first indoor rally stage of its kind Sept 17th 2005 at Cardiff in the Millennium Stadium.The course was a simple 8 which showed the cars driving sideways more than on a straight line, showing the spectators what these cars and drivers can do. There were also other great benefits for the spectators, you saw the cars for all the stage, fantastic lighting and the noise with the closed roof added to the atmosphere.
The only disadvantage I could see was the slow speeds needed to complete the stage and of course the lack of jumps etc., but then, why have the rally outside at all, if indoor events can capture every aspect of rally driving.
